BPC‑157 is a synthetic peptide derived from body protective compound 157 a naturally occurring protein fragment that has been studied primarily in laboratory settings for its potential to accelerate tissue repair and reduce inflammation. While it is marketed as a supplement by some online vendors the scientific evidence supporting its use in humans remains limited and largely anecdotal. The majority of studies have been conducted on animals or in vitro with only a handful of small human case reports suggesting possible benefits for tendon ligament muscle nerve and gastric healing. Because regulatory bodies such as the FDA have not approved BPC‑157 for any medical indication its safety profile long‑term effects and interactions with other medications are not well established. For men who are considering taking BPC‑157 to enhance recovery from injuries or chronic pain it is essential to understand that there is no standardized dosage regimen. BPC‑157 is a synthetic peptide that has attracted considerable attention in the fields of sports medicine regenerative biology and alternative therapeutics. Its reputation stems from a growing body of preclinical studies that demonstrate remarkable healing properties across a variety of tissues including muscle tendon ligament nerve and even gastric mucosa. While clinical data in humans remain limited the scientific literature supports many potential applications ranging from injury recovery to gastrointestinal protection. What Is BPC‑157? BPC‑157 stands for Body Protective Compound 157. It is a synthetic hexapeptide that mimics a naturally occurring segment of a protein found in human gastric juice. The peptide consists of 15 amino acids and was originally isolated from the body’s protective mechanisms within the stomach lining. Researchers have synthesized BPC‑157 in laboratory settings allowing for controlled dosing and investigation into its therapeutic properties. |
